Scenario: A company is experiencing resource contention issues when running Hive queries with Apache Spark. As a Hive with Apache Spark expert, how would you optimize resource utilization and ensure efficient query execution?
- Increase cluster capacity
- Optimize memory management
- Optimize shuffle operations
- Utilize dynamic resource allocation
To optimize resource utilization and ensure efficient query execution in a Hive with Apache Spark environment experiencing resource contention, one should focus on optimizing memory management, increasing cluster capacity, utilizing dynamic resource allocation, and optimizing shuffle operations. These strategies help prevent resource bottlenecks, improve overall system performance, and ensure smooth query execution even under high workload demands.
Loading...
Related Quiz
- How does YARN facilitate resource management for Hive queries in the Hadoop ecosystem?
- What role does Apache Druid play in the Hive architecture when integrated?
- User-Defined Functions can be used to implement complex ________ logic in Hive queries.
- What are the primary methods used for recovering data in Hive?
- Scenario: A large e-commerce company wants to analyze real-time clickstream data for personalized recommendations. They are considering integrating Hive with Apache Druid. What factors should they consider when designing the architecture for this integration to meet their requirements?